What is the difference between Radiation Protection vs Radiation Technologist?

AspectRadiation ProtectionRadiation Technologist
CertificationsCertified Health Physicist, Radiation Safety OfficerARRT Certification, Radiologic Technologist License
Work EnvironmentIndustrial, medical, nuclear facilities focusing on safety protocolsHospitals, clinics performing diagnostic imaging
Primary FocusEnsuring safety and compliance with radiation regulationsPerforming diagnostic imaging procedures

Radiation Protection professionals focus on safety, compliance, and radiation risk management, often working in regulatory or industrial settings. Radiation Technologists primarily operate imaging equipment in medical environments. While both roles involve radiation, their responsibilities, certifications, and work environments differ significantly.

How to get a job in radiation protection?

To get a job in radiation protection, candidates typically need a relevant degree such as health physics, radiological science, or a related field, along with certification like the Certified Health Physicist (CHP) or Radiation Safety Officer (RSO). Gaining experience through internships or entry-level positions in medical, industrial, or nuclear settings is also valuable. Strong understanding of radiation safety protocols, regulatory compliance, and safety equipment is essential for success in this field.

What are some common challenges faced by professionals in radiation protection, and how can they be addressed?

Professionals in Radiation Protection often encounter challenges such as staying updated with evolving safety regulations, effectively communicating risks to non-technical staff, and ensuring strict compliance in fast-paced or high-risk environments. Addressing these challenges involves continuous professional development, clear documentation, and regular training sessions for all personnel. Building strong collaboration with other departments and maintaining open communication channels also help in fostering a culture of safety and compliance.

What are the key skills and qualifications needed to thrive in radiation protection?

To thrive in Radiation Protection, you need a solid understanding of radiation physics, safety protocols, and regulatory compliance, typically supported by a degree in health physics, nuclear engineering, or a related field. Familiarity with dosimetry equipment, radiation detection instruments, and certifications such as Certified Health Physicist (CHP) are commonly required. Strong analytical thinking, attention to detail, and effective communication skills help professionals assess hazards and convey safety information clearly. These skills are essential to ensure the safe use of radioactive materials and protect workers and the public from radiation exposure.

How hard is it to become a radiation protection technician?

Becoming a radiation protection technician typically requires completing a relevant post-secondary program or training in radiation safety, followed by obtaining certification such as the Certified Radiation Protection Technician (CRPT). The job involves understanding radiation safety protocols, using detection instruments, and adhering to regulatory standards, which requires technical knowledge and attention to detail. The difficulty depends on prior education and experience in health physics or related fields.

What is radiation protection?

Radiation protection professionals, also known as health physicists or radiation safety officers, are specialists who ensure the safe use of radiation and radioactive materials in medical, industrial, research, and nuclear settings. Their primary responsibility is to protect people and the environment from the harmful effects of ionizing radiation by monitoring exposure levels, implementing safety protocols, and ensuring regulatory compliance. They also educate staff, respond to radiation emergencies, and maintain records of radiation usage and incidents.

The BASS Radiation Oncology Department is seeking a Staff Radiation Therapist to join a forward-thinking team committed to creating and maintaining a culture of collaboration amongst the entire team to provide accurate, innovative and compassionate care to the patients utilizing Elekta VersaHD and Viewray MRIdian Linac. The successful candidate is responsible for administering therapeutic doses of ionizing radiation; using advanced level linear accelerators and other treatment units; and record and verify treatment software; as well as simulating patients in accordance with prescription and instruction of the Radiation Oncologists. They reliably and accurately document treatments delivered, and respectively and compassionately interact with patients.
Duties:
  • Deliver accurate, efficient and reproducible radiation therapy treatments as indicated by prescription.
  • Proper use of a linear accelerator, use of beam monitoring equipment, TLDs, use of appropriate treatment devices, and correct chart and port film documentation.
  • Review diagnosis, patient chart, and identification. Review diagnosis, patient chart, and identification.
  • Perform morning warm up QA for linear accelerator and PET/CT machines.
  • Perform accurate and efficient radiation therapy treatment simulations. This includes proper use of a simulator, fabrication of various treatment devices, including custom blocks and basic dosimetry. Along with Photograph and tattooing of patients as required.
  • Recognize and report malfunctioning equipment.
  • Ability to communicate and work effectively with physicians and other staff, recognizing the importance of cooperation and contribution to a team effort.
  • Ability to adapt to changing circumstances and multitask.
  • Ability to communicate effectively with patients from diverse social and cultural backgrounds, making them feel comfortable while helping to ensure a high level of patient satisfaction. This includes patients who are severely ill and incapacitated.
  • Ability to frequently lift, move, and transfer patients. Also, must be able to lift and move supplies and equipment.
  • Take daily/weekly imaging to analyze and accurately reproduce patient positioning.
  • Follow principles of radiation protection for patient, self, and others. Aware of MRI safety protocols.

Requirements
Education / Certificates / Licenses
  • Completion of a 24-month course in radiologic technology and 12-month course in radiation therapy, or a Bachelor of Science degree in radiation therapy.
  • Licensure as a Radiation Therapy Technologist, ARRT certification
  • Licensure as a Radiation Therapy Technologist, California State License (CRT)
  • BLS/CPR Certification

Required skills, knowledge, and abilities
  • Knowledge of Radiation Oncology Treatment and Imaging platforms utilizing the latest treatment techniques including 3D Conformal, IMRT, IGRT, SRS/SBRT, and brachytherapy procedures, clinical and operational workflows related to radiation treatment delivery, patient billing, oncology care environments, and regulatory standards.
  • CT/Simulation experience in all areas of radiation therapy, including brachytherapy.
  • Knowledge of the human anatomy and proper positioning of the patient to provide treatment as prescribed.
  • Experience and/or training in treatment delivery systems and EHR platforms (Mosaiq EHR, Epic EHR, VersaHD, AlignRT)
